Output d68df79672d75bf0fef2508d5eade6cfe8a60f5548dfd8d148fb019e6f09df12:1

value
105634
script pubkey
OP_0 OP_PUSHBYTES_20 e8f5d4831b5226d4c97ea95032950be0a2b9bcc4
address
bc1qar6afqcm2gndfjt749gr99gtuz3tn0xyzqrv6r
transaction
d68df79672d75bf0fef2508d5eade6cfe8a60f5548dfd8d148fb019e6f09df12
confirmations
127163
spent
true